Zack Snyder recently shared a poster for his Superman movie, Man of Steel. The graphic poster is one of a number of throwbacks to the DCEU that Snyder has shared with fans on social media. It drops as DC co-CEO and director James Gunn has also begun to share more promotional material for his upcoming Superman sequel, Man of Tomorrow.

Zack Snyder recently posted an image of a poster for Man of Steel, and it might be something fans have never seen before.

The director shared a poster for the 2013 movie and wrote in the caption, “Awesome Man of Steel poster.” The poster, which features hues of orange and deep black, depicts the destruction of Superman’s home planet, Krypton. Fans can also spot a spaceship seemingly carrying Kal-El (Superman) away from the devastation and ascending into the sky.

The poster also features the Superman “S” logo with the title underneath that. Although Snyder didn’t reveal who illustrated the poster, a listing on the French Paper Art Club’s website states that it was made by Dan Mumford. According to the website, Mumford said he wanted to tackle the world of Superman differently with this artwork. He added that he was impressed by the world of Krypton, which Snyder showcased in the movie, but was left disappointed by the little screen time it got. Thus, the poster is his way of paying tribute to the significant event in Superman’s life that occurred on the planet.

Man of Steel was released in 2013 and stars Henry Cavill as Superman. The iconic superhero is now portrayed on the big screen by David Corenswet in James Gunn’s DCU. Corenswet will next appear in Supergirl and James Gunn’s Superman sequel Man of Tomorrow.
